46.51.241.126
46.51.241.126 is an IPv4 address allocated within the 46.51.224.0/19 netblock,
which holds total of 8,192 unique IP addresses.
The route is managed by Amazon Web Services, Elastic Compute Cloud, EC2 The activity you have detected originates from a dynamic hosting environment. For fastest response, please submit abuse reports at http://aws-portal.amazon.com/gp/aws/html-forms-controller/contactus/AWSAbuse identified by ASN 16509,
which was allocated on 21 Jun 2024
by the ARIN internet registry.
The IP address is located in
Tokyo, Japan.
The postal code is 102-0082.